Embattled FIFA President Infantino ‘turns to Donald Trump in bid to save his job’

FIFA President Gianni Infantino is reportedly seeking the support of US President Donald Trump as he battles mounting pressure over his future at the helm of world football’s governing body.

Infantino sparked an open revolt when The Times first revealed his bombshell plans to sell a $4.2 billion (£3.1bn) stake in FIFA’s flagship tournament to a private equity firm led by Joshua Kushner.

The proposals have since been scrapped after opposition from UEFA, the North, Central America and Caribbean confederation (CONCACAF) and the Asian Football Confederation (AFC).

According to The New York Post, Infantino is now turning to his biggest ally – Donald Trump – to help him survive.

The paper reported that Infantino will hold a call with US Secretary of State Marco Rubio at 9am EST (2pm BST), as pressure rises on the FIFA president to resign from his role.

An insider told the Post: ‘He wanted to get online with the secretary and talk about how soccer can be a form of soft power for America. But we all know that it is about job protection. It is not about anything else at this point.’

A second source described Infantino as feeling ‘isolated’ by the ‘avalanche’ of negativity surrounding his now-doomed plans. ‘He is looking for allies of note to publicly support him,’ they said.

Infantino’s alleged last-ditch attempt to save his presidency comes just days after Trump brutally denied all knowledge of Infantino’s bold sell-off plan.

When asked ‘did Mr Infantino speak to you about his proposal to sell a stake in the World Cup?’ Trump brutally first replied: ‘Who?’

After the question was repeated, the president then added: ‘No, I didn’t speak to him.’
